Hey, guys, I just want to know if the following sentences need any correction or correct in grammaar. If any needs correction, please give it a detailed correction.
- There are found several sorts of houses
Several kinds of houses can be found. We don't normally say "There are found..."
- They are eligible to mortgage houses for a loan equivalent to as much as 60% worth of a house
Mortgages are available, for up to as much as 60% of the value of a house.
- a combined cafe for pets that will serve as a breeder, a pet item shop working on pet beauty.
A place/location/venue combining a pet café, a breeder, a pet goods shop and a pet grooming service.
- a somewhat spacious business, coruning (this is not a word) both as a cafe and a shop for garden plants.
A quite spacious location, which is both a café and a garden plant shop.
We don't normally describe a "business" as "spacious" - spacious refers to a physical space, whereas a business is simply another name for a company.
